Viscosity and Density of Boron Trioxide
Extensive and accurate viscosity values for molten B 2 O 3 are reported over the continuous range from 20 poises (at 1400°C) to 10 10 poises (at 318°C). Magnetic-Field Dependence of the Rf Skin Depth of Gallium
The variation with magnetic field of the surface reactance of gallium single crystals at 2 Mc/sec has been investigated at helium temperatures and for fields up to 1500 G. Scattering of Long-Wavelength Phonons by Point Imperfections in Crystals
At very low temperatures the thermal conductivity of insulating crystals containing point defects is limited by boundary relaxation processes and by Rayleigh scattering of long-wavelength phonons: at higher temperatures resonant modifications of Rayleigh scattering and phonon-phonon scattering dominate. Electron-Phonon Interaction in Organic Molecular Crystals
A theory of acoustic-mode scattering has been formulated within the tight-binding approximation of band theory, and has been applied to narrow-band semiconduction in organic molecular crystals. Differential Cross Section for Trident Production
This paper discusses the differential cross section for pair production by electron scattering off an arbitrary fixed potential (trident). Synthesis of corroles and related ring systems
Abstract Corroles have been prepared by the irradiation of basic solutions of 1,19-dideoxybiladienes-ac. Some physical and chemical properties of corroles are described including the formation of the aromatic corrole anions. Space Charge in Ionic Crystals. I. General Approach with Application to NaCl
The defect distribution in an ionic crystal is calculated for both pure crystals and crystals containing divalent cationic impurities. Nuclear-Magnetic-Resonance Line Narrowing by a Rotating rf Field
A nuclear-magnetic-resonance method is explored, which effectively attenuates the dipolar interaction in solids. The experimental technique corresponds to the observation of a free-induction decay in a frame of reference rotating with the frequency of an applied rf field.
